How to hard reset Lenovo A7000

1. To start, turn off the phone using the POWER button.

2. At the same time, press and hold the Volume Up(+) and Volume down button.

3. Holding these keys, press the POWER button for a few seconds.

4. Release all buttons when you appear Recovery mode.

5. Highlight wipe data / factory reset Use the Volume Down button and then press the POWER button to confirm.

6. Select Yes - Delete All User Data. Use the Volume Down(-) button to scroll and the POWER button to select.

7. Overload the phone, select reboot system now and press the POWER button to confirm.




Hard Reset - advantages and disadvantages Lenovo A7000?

In simple words, Hard Reset means hard resetting the phone. As a result, the system automatically returns to the factory settings and the system is completely cleared. Contacts, correspondence, application, files, search queries, passwords - all of this is deleted from the device's memory.

Benefits of Hard Reset:
The ability to get a completely clean phone from user settings and data.
Removal of viruses that block applications on the device and give persistent errors.
Solving various problems on the device that arise due to the conflict of applications.

Disadvantages of Hard Reset:
All your data and media files will be deleted.
The need to have an up-to-date backup of your data, contacts, settings and media files.
Not all viruses on Android can be removed even after returning to factory settings.


What needs to be done before the Hard Reset operation.
If you are going to do a hard reset on your phone, then be sure to make sure that you know the access data for your google account.
Before a hard reset, you must first log out of your google account. In this case, after performing a factory reset, the phone will not be locked by the FRP.
If after resetting the settings you cannot log into your Google account, then you need to find instructions for bypassing the FRP lock for your phone model.
You will need to contact the official service center to bypass the FRP protection on some new phone models.

After performing a hard reset, your device will be completely wiped clean. Everything that was in the memory of your device will be deleted.

What can be done to avoid losing important information?
If important information (contacts, sms, photos, videos) remains in the memory of your device, then there are the following options to save it:

Sync your data with Google contacts, Google drive.
Backup your contacts and information.
Using the service programs for your phone model, you can transfer important data to your PC.
